Telecom Minister Said – 5G Will Be Launched In Early October

Telecom Minister said – 5G will be launched in early October this year; Service will be cheaper than in other countries of the world: 5G in India.

Telecom Minister Ashwini Vaishnav has said that the 5G service will be launched in the country in early October this year.

He said that mobile phones capable of providing 5G service are currently available in the market for up to Rs 15,000 and soon such phones will be available in the market for up to Rs 10,000.

He has spoken to mobile phone manufacturers in this regard.

Vaishnav said that the 5G service in India will be much cheaper than in other countries of the world as the cost of data is already very low in our country.

The average monthly cost of mobile internet in the world for common consumers is Rs 2500, while in India it is done for less than Rs 200.

Vaishnav said that the market will decide the pricing of the 5G service, but it is necessary that the price of the 5G service will not be such that people face problems.

He said that the 5G spectrum auction is going on and the spectrum will be allotted to the companies as soon as the auction is over.

However, after spectrum allocation, it takes a few months for companies to install equipment.

But talks have already been held with telecom service providers in this regard, so 5G service is expected to start in early October.

5G trial is going on in these cities of the country.

5G trials are already going on in four places in the country. These include Bhopal City, Bangalore Metro, Kandla Port, and Delhi Airport.

This trial will go a long way in preparing 5G infrastructure in advance. In this regard, TRAI has also submitted a report to the Department of Telecom.

BSNL will also start the 5G service.

Vaishnav said that even after the introduction of the 5G service, the importance of 4G will remain. In countries where 5G has been started, 4G service is still fully running.

However, after the launch of 5G in India, the scope of 5G will grow rapidly as this service is being launched with full preparation.

He told that BSNL will also start 5G service, but before that BSNL will start fully 4G service.

Vaishnav said that in the next two-three years, like electronics items, India will also become a big manufacturer of telecom equipment.
